Output a070647ecdf24ef595f0882e99bdc0300ad2babdf59b77ced49f3eaa110bc736:0

value
2128318
script pubkey
OP_0 OP_PUSHBYTES_20 efcb6b65b86c4de0e5d8171862a351c081ba17ed
address
bc1qal9kkedcd3x7pewczuvx9g63czqm59ld8jg3v4
transaction
a070647ecdf24ef595f0882e99bdc0300ad2babdf59b77ced49f3eaa110bc736
confirmations
112503
spent
true